Industry Recognized Curriculum and Academic Excellence
LPU's program is accredited by the National Board of Accreditation (NBA), ensuring quality and industry relevance. The program is designed to equip students with a solid foundation in engineering principles, mathematical concepts, and analytical skills. This robust curriculum prepares graduates for success in various industries, including software engineering, research and development, data science, product management, consulting, engineering management, and entrepreneurship.
Top Placement Records and Leading Employers
LPU consistently ranks among the top engineering institutes in India. In the NIRF (National Institutional Ranking Framework) Ranking of 2024, LPU stands at the 50th position, and it is ranked 9th in Computer Science by the Times Higher Education World University Ranking 2024. This boosts the earning potential and industry recognition of LPU graduates, making them highly sought after by top companies.

Palo Alto Networks Amazon Software Development India Ltd Tri Logic Innovations Cisco Data Insights InforMatica IBM Google Infosys Bosch Samsung Voltas Elitmus Evaluation PVT Ltd Atlan OVHCloud MyOURCEIn addition to these top-tier companies, LPU conducts special preparation classes for final placement drives, known as PEP (Placement Enhancement Program) classes. These classes are held every Saturday and focus on preparing students for real-time placement scenarios, including group discussions, communication skills, soft skills, analytical thinking, and resume building. Extensive mock interviews and Group Discussions (GDs) are also a part of the curriculum to ensure students are fully prepared.
